TODAY AT FAITH LUTHERAN Trojans, Bulldogs clash in 3-A mat showdown
By DON McDERMOTT
Pahrump Valley goes to Las Vegas today to wrestle Mesquite Virgin Valley, with an undisputed Southern Nevada Class 3-A League championship the prize if the Trojans prevail. The Trojans, 5-0 in the league and 20-3 in all duals this season, and Bulldogs will clash at 3 p.m. in the Faith Lutheran High School gym. Pahrump Valley defeated the Bulldogs 56-22 at Boulder City in December. "But Virgin Valley was without a couple wrestlers that day; they are healthy and back in the lineup," said Craig Rieger, the Pahrump Valley coach, who is expecting the Bulldogs to be at peak efficiency today. A Trojan win will move PVHS to 6-0 in the league, with duals remaining against Faith Lutheran and Moapa Valley. The Trojans are 2-0 against Boulder City and 1-0 against Faith, Moapa Valley and Virgin Valley. Faith Lutheran, the host team today, will wrestle Virgin Valley and Boulder City. Pahrump Valley was 3-1 in the Basic Duals in Henderson Friday, beating Basic 39-32, Las Vegas Del Sol 66-13 and Sierra Vista 65-6, while bowing 43-24 to Spring Valley. In that latter dual, PVHS wrestlers lost three matches in overtime. Pahrump Valley's wrestlers leave Thursday for Spring Creek, where they will be competing in the prestigious Kiwanis Invitational Friday and Saturday. Wrestlers from more than 25 schools will go after individual titles, as well as score enough points to give their teams the overall championship. In the 2007 tournament, Minico, Idaho, won the team championship, outpointing Class 4-A Churchill County Fallon and the host Spartans. Pahrump Valley was to have wrestled in that tournament, but the trip was canceled because of bad weather. The results Pahrump Valley had 14 wrestlers in the Basic Duals. The results (overall record in parenthesis): 103 pounds -- Elliot Owens 2-2 (21-7); 112 -- Elias Armendariz 4-0 (30-3). 119 -- Josh Armendariz 1-3 (15-11). 125 -- Paul Miller 2-2. 130 -- Chris DeMille 2-2. 135 -- Gueran Fenicle 2-2. 140 -- Maverik Manning 2-2. 145 -- James Chapman 3-1 (28-5). 152 -- Jarod Lydon 3-1. 160 -- Ande Floyd 4-0 (21-7). 171 -- Zach Weldon 4-0 (32-2). 189 -- Joe Colucci 2-2 (18-12). 215 -- Pierce Henkel 2-2 (24-7). 285 -- Frank Lopez 4-0 (30-3). Lydon, a junior, made his varsity debut for the Trojans. Manning substituted for Kyle Abreu (16-12) at 140. Henkel lost two overtime matches, while Fenicle also fell in an extra period. |
